A prominent children's hospice in Devizes is seeking a qualified Team Nurse to deliver family-centered respite care for children with life-limiting conditions. This role requires providing care in both hospice and community settings, alongside the capability to assist with end-of-life care when necessary. The ideal candidate will embody the values and behaviors of the hospice, ensuring a compassionate approach to nursing care.

How to prepare for a job interview at Julia's House

Know Your Values

Before the interview, take some time to reflect on the values and behaviours of the hospice. Be ready to discuss how your personal values align with theirs, especially in terms of compassion and family-centred care.

Showcase Your Experience

Prepare specific examples from your past experiences that highlight your skills in providing respite care and end-of-life support.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ses clearly.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

Come prepared with questions that show your genuine interest in the role and the organisation. Inquire about their approach to community support and how they involve families in the care process.

Practice Empathy in Responses

During the interview, demonstrate your ability to empathise with both children and their families. Share stories that illustrate your compassionate approach to nursing, as this is crucial for a role in paediatric palliative care.
